The Night of Glory: Comprehension the importance of Laylat al-Qadr

Laylat al-Qadr, also referred to as the Evening of Glory, holds immense significance in Islam mainly because it marks the night once the Quran was to start with disclosed to Prophet Muhammad (peace be on him). This sacred night, typically known as the Night time of Ability, takes place through the last 10 days of Ramadan and is considered to generally be a lot better than a thousand months when it comes to blessings and divine mercy. Being familiar with Laylat al-Qadr:
Laylat al-Qadr holds a Particular position while in the hearts of Muslims all over the world due to its profound spiritual importance. The precise day of Laylat al-Qadr is not known, although it is commonly believed to take place on one of several odd-numbered evenings throughout the final 10 times of Ramadan, Using the 27th evening currently being the most widely noticed. The Quran describes Laylat al-Qadr as a night of peace and blessings, all through which angels descend to earth and divine decrees are made for the coming 12 months.

The importance of Laylat al-Qadr:
The importance of Laylat al-Qadr is highlighted in various verses with the Quran, including Surah Al-Qadr, which describes the night time as currently being much better than a thousand months. This means that any act of worship carried out on Laylat al-Qadr is thought of as extra worthwhile than worship executed above a thousand months. Therefore, Muslims are encouraged to hunt out Laylat al-Qadr and have interaction in acts of worship which include prayer, supplication, and recitation from the Quran.

The lailatulqadar Evening of Destiny:
Laylat al-Qadr is also referred to as the Evening of Destiny, as it is actually considered for being the night when Allah decrees the destiny of individuals for the approaching 12 months. Muslims think that on this night time, divine blessings and mercy are ample, and sincere prayers are more likely to be answered. Hence, believers are encouraged to seize the opportunity offered by Laylat al-Qadr to seek forgiveness, assistance, and blessings from Allah.

Observing Laylat al-Qadr:
Muslims observe Laylat al-Qadr with acts of worship and devotion through the entire evening. Several devote the night in prayer for the mosque, partaking in Particular prayers referred to as Taraweeh and Qiyam ul-Layl. Some others shell out the night time in your own home, engaging in private worship, recitation of the Quran, and supplication. It's really a time of intensive spiritual reflection and renewal, as believers seek to attract nearer to Allah and achieve His mercy and forgiveness.
